Sandwich Shop Sales Analysis

Hard Arithmetic Fractions, Decimals, And Percents

A sandwich shop offers two types of sandwiches: a vegetarian sandwich and a meat sandwich. The vegetarian sandwich costs $5 and is typically 60% of the total sales. The meat sandwich costs $8 and accounts for the remaining sales. If the shop made a total of $800 in sales in one day, how much money did they make from each type of sandwich?

Determine the monetary amounts made from each sandwich type and find out what percent of the total sales each sandwich represented.
